Property Details for 359 Priestleys Lane, Birralee

359 Priestleys Lane, Birralee is a 3 bedroom, 1 bathroom House with 2 parking spaces and was built in 1986. The property has a land size of 6292m2 and floor size of 108m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in June 2010.

About Birralee 7303

The size of Birralee is approximately 43.3 square kilometres. It has 3 parks covering nearly 7.4% of total area. The population of Birralee in 2011 was 361 people. By 2016 the population was 182 showing a population decline of 49.6%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Birralee is 50-59 years. Households in Birralee are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ying under $300 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Birralee work in a trades occupation. In 2011, 81.6% of the homes in Birralee were owner-occupied compared with 91.5% in 2016..
